Abstract

The utility model discloses a kind of for driving the connector on motor output shaft, it includes connecting outer shroud and connecting internal ring, and the inner ring surface connecting outer shroud is taper surface, and the one end connecting outer shroud is provided with flange, connects outer shroud and is connected with flange coaxial and one-body molded;Connecting internal ring and include inserting section and the canned paragraph of annular that outer ring surface is taper, inserting section is coaxially connected with canned paragraph and one-body molded;Inserting section is connected in connection outer shroud by one end sleeve away from flange;The external diameter of canned paragraph is more than the external diameter of inserting section, and canned paragraph connects by fastening bolt is fixing with being connected outer shroud.This utility model has that transmission moment of torsion is big, simple in construction, accuracy of alignment high, bound fraction fits tightly and is difficult to corrosion and has the advantages such as good interchangeability.

Background technology:
The output driving motor power is dependent on flange and is connected with motor output shaft, and then flange is connected with power transmission shaft to come again Realize, and the connection of traditional flange and motor output shaft uses spline or interference to connect, and does not has the function of overload protection, when When moment of torsion is excessive, output shaft is likely to occur fracture.Additionally use spline to connect because there being keyway, the intensity of connector can be cut Weak, use interference to connect, the highest to the requirement on machining accuracy of connector, make manufacture difficulty increase, and cost increases.

Detailed description of the invention:
For making the technical problems to be solved in the utility model, technical scheme and advantage clearer, below in conjunction with accompanying drawing And specific embodiment is described in detail.
As it is shown in figure 1, in embodiment of the present utility model, it is provided that a kind of for driving the connection on motor output shaft Part, it includes connecting outer shroud 2 and connecting internal ring 1, connects internal ring 1 and be set on the output shaft 3 of motor, connect the internal ring of outer shroud 2 Face is taper surface, and the one end connecting outer shroud 2 is provided with flange 5, connects outer shroud 2 coaxially connected with flange 5 and one-body molded;In connecting Ring 1 includes inserting section 101 and the canned paragraph 102 of annular that outer ring surface is taper, and inserting section 101 is provided with two vertically Calking 103.Inserting section 101 is coaxially connected with canned paragraph 102 and one-body molded;Inserting section 101 is by one end sleeve away from flange 5 It is connected in connection outer shroud 2;The external diameter of canned paragraph 102 is more than the external diameter of inserting section 101, and canned paragraph 102 passes through with being connected outer shroud 2 Fastening bolt 4 is fixing to be connected.
The use installation process of the present embodiment, as illustrated in fig. 1 and 2, first enters to connect in outer shroud 2 by sheathed for output shaft 3, adjusts After good longitudinal separation, then snapping fit onto in inserting section 101 by sheathed for connection outer shroud 2, the outer wall of inserting section 101 is connected to connect outer shroud On the inner ring surface of 2, finally fastening bolt 4 is sequentially passed through connection outer shroud 2 and canned paragraph 102 so that outside connecting internal ring 1 and connecting Ring 2 connects, and this utility model utilizes flange 5 outer shroud and connects the corresponding cone structure of internal ring 1, under the pulling force of fastening bolt 4 Connect outer shroud 2 to be compacted on output shaft 3 by connection internal ring 1;In specific embodiment of the utility model, Plug Division is arranged and opens The purpose of calking 103 is when connecting outer shroud 2 and being pressed on Plug Division, tensioning seam 103 Guan Bi, is compacted to Plug Division defeated further On shaft 3.
